How often is the Initial Preventive Physical Examination (IPPE) offered to beneficiaries?

Explanation:
The Initial Preventive Physical Examination (IPPE), also known as the "Welcome to Medicare" visit, is offered to Medicare beneficiaries once in a lifetime. This examination serves as a preventive service that allows new beneficiaries to receive a comprehensive health evaluation. During this visit, healthcare providers review the beneficiary's medical history, perform various screenings, and offer counseling on preventive services relevant to their age and health needs. Understanding the significance of this service can help beneficiaries maximize their health benefits upon entering Medicare. While there are multiple preventive services available annually, the IPPE itself is limited to just one occurrence per beneficiary, clearly establishing it as a unique entry point into the Medicare preventive health services framework.
